I'm I the only 1 with this situation...when the light goes on at about 140 to 160kms telling me I'm low on fuel and the gauge showing only 1 bar...I drive up to the pumps only to find out I still have 7 to 8 litres left based on a 35.6L tank capacity which is already smaller by 3L +/- previous models, is this the norm, with my '05 RX1 I usually had 3 to 4 litres, just curious if other '08 owners noticed the same?
Is this something that can be calibrated to get a better reading on fuel gauge and warning light sync.
